The Door Lock Assembly is an OEM part for Bosch washing machines. It secures the washer door during wash cycles. The lock assembly prevents accidental opening of the door while also allowing easy access for loading and unloading once the cycle is complete.
Causes of a bad door lock assembly can include normal wear and tear over extended use, as well as repeated impact or unintentional contact with the lock area during operation which can damage lock components.
Symptoms of a bad door lock assembly include:
- The door not latching or locking properly during wash cycles
- Difficulty fully closing or sealing the door
- Repeated triggering of door open or door lock error messages
- loosening or sagging of the door over time

The Drain Pump is an OEM part for Bosch washing machines. It is responsible for removing water from the washer drum during the drain cycle, ensuring that the washing process completes efficiently. The pump forces the water out through the drain hose, preventing water from pooling in the drum.
Causes of a bad drain pump can include blockages from debris, wear and tear from regular use, or electrical issues.
Symptoms of a bad washer drain pump include:
- The washer not draining water
- Unusual noises during the drain cycle
- Error codes related to drainage issues on the washer’s display
- Water left in the drum after the wash cycle

Good idea to snap a few picture on iPhone or digital camera as you go along.
Remove 16 torque screws from back metal panel
Pull down small plastic panel (6 by 4 inches), front right by pressing down locking tab, and once off, remove torque screw in centre next to round plastic drain trap.

The Carbon Brush is an OEM part for Bosch washing machines. It plays a crucial role in conducting electrical current between the stationary and moving parts of the motor, enabling the motor to run efficiently. This component ensures proper motor function, which is essential for the washer's operation.
Causes of a bad carbon brush can include normal wear and tear due to regular use, dirt and debris causing the brushes to wear out faster, or improper maintenance. As the brushes wear down, they become less effective at conducting electricity, which can lead to motor issues.
Symptoms of a bad carbon brush include:
- The washing machine motor not starting
- Sparking or unusual noises from the motor area
- The washer running intermittently or losing power during cycles
- Reduced washing performance or the drum not spinning properly

The Shock Absorber is an OEM part for Bosch washing machines. The shock absorber reduces vibrations during spin cycles to minimize component and machine wear.
The shock absorber is designed to cushion movements from unbalanced loads or rough spins. It absorbs shocks to provide a stable operation and protect delicate parts.
Causes of a bad shock absorber can include damage from overloaded or out-of-balance loads over time. Deterioration may arise from long-term usage stresses and environmental exposures like chemical spills.
Symptoms of a bad shock absorber include:
- Excessive shaking and noise during spin
- Gradual loosening of the machine's mounting fixtures
- Deterioration that leads to premature component failures

This valve magnet is the electromagnetic coil that actuates the appliance's valve, allowing the control to start and stop flow as needed. Replacing a weak or open coil restores dependable valve operation and proper cycle performance.
- Converts electrical signals into magnetic force to move the valve plunger
- Opens and closes the mated valve on command to regulate flow during cycles
- Failure symptoms include no flow, continuous flow, intermittent operation, or related error codes
- A weakened coil can cause the valve to hum without actuating
What's included: 1 valve magnet
- Disconnect power and shut off any supply before servicing
- Access the valve and note wire positions for correct reassembly
- Slide the new coil fully onto the valve body; ensure proper orientation and seating
- Reconnect wiring, restore supply, and test for correct operation and leaks
